Understanding 316 Stainless Steel
316 stainless steel is an alloy known for its superior corrosion resistance compared to other stainless steels. It contains molybdenum, which significantly enhances its ability to withstand corrosive environments, including saltwater. This property makes 316 stainless steel the preferred choice for marine applications where exposure to seawater is common. The addition of nickel also contributes to its overall strength and ductility. This means that screws made from 316 stainless steel can maintain their integrity even when subjected to mechanical stress.
What Are Self-Tapping Screws?
Self-tapping screws are designed to create their own hole as they are driven into a material. This feature eliminates the need for pre-drilling, saving time and effort during the installation process. Furthermore, self-tapping screws come with sharp, specially designed threads that cut through materials, ensuring a snug fit and strong hold.
Advantages of 316 Stainless Steel Self-Tapping Screws
1. Corrosion Resistance The primary advantage of using 316 stainless steel self-tapping screws is their exceptional resistance to corrosion. This is particularly important in applications near bodies of water or in industrial settings where moisture and chemicals are present. Unlike carbon steel screws, which may rust quickly, 316 stainless steel screws can last for years, maintaining their appearance and functionality.
2. Strength and Durability 316 stainless steel provides high tensile strength, reducing the risk of screw failure under heavy loads. This strength is imperative in construction and heavy-duty applications, ensuring that structures remain secure and intact over time.
3. Versatile Applications These screws are ideal for a wide range of applications, including those in demanding environments. They are commonly used in marine construction, outdoor furniture, HVAC systems, and even in the food processing industry, where sanitation and corrosion resistance are paramount.
4. Ease of Installation With their self-tapping design, installation is quick and straightforward. Users can save time and labor costs, which is crucial in large-scale projects. The ability to use these screws without needing to drill pilot holes simplifies assembly processes in manufacturing and construction.
5. Aesthetic Appeal 316 stainless steel has a modern, clean appearance that does not tarnish or discolor over time. This characteristic makes these screws suitable for visible applications, such as in high-end furniture or architectural designs where aesthetics are carefully considered.
